//Standard generators of the Mathieu group M22 are a and b where a has order 2,
//b is in class 4A, ab has order 11 and ababb has order 11.
//Standard generators of the double cover 2.M22 are preimages A and B where A is
//in +2A, B is in -4A and AB has order 11 (any two of these conditions imply the
//third). An equivalent set of conditions is that AB has order 11 and ABABB has
//order 11.
